一、人工智能的定义与演进:从概念到技术落地
人工智能(Artificial Intelligence,AI)的核心目标是通过计算机系统模拟人类智能行为,包括学习、推理、感知和决策等能力。其发展历程可分为三个阶段:
- 符号主义阶段(1950s-1980s):以规则驱动为核心,通过预设逻辑实现简单任务(如专家系统),但受限于知识库的完整性和推理效率。
- 连接主义阶段(1990s-2010s):神经网络与深度学习的兴起,通过多层非线性变换自动提取特征,突破了传统方法的局限性。例如,2012年AlexNet在图像分类任务中显著超越传统算法,标志着深度学习时代的开启。
- 大数据与算力驱动阶段(2010s至今):GPU集群与分布式训练框架(如TensorFlow、PyTorch)的普及,使得大规模模型训练成为可能。以自然语言处理(NLP)为例,Transformer架构的出现(如BERT、GPT系列)推动了语言模型的跨越式发展。
关键点:AI的演进本质是数据、算法与算力的协同进化,开发者需关注三者平衡以实现高效建模。
二、AI技术基础:算法、数据与工具链
1. 核心算法解析
- 监督学习:通过标注数据训练模型,适用于分类(如图像识别)和回归(如房价预测)任务。例如,使用Scikit-learn实现线性回归:
from sklearn.linear_model import LinearRegressionmodel = LinearRegression()model.fit(X_train, y_train) # X_train为特征,y_train为标签
- 无监督学习:挖掘数据内在结构,常见方法包括聚类(K-Means)和降维(PCA)。例如,对用户行为数据进行聚类分析以识别用户群体。
- 强化学习:通过环境交互学习最优策略,广泛应用于游戏AI(如AlphaGo)和机器人控制。
2. 数据处理与特征工程
数据质量直接影响模型性能,需关注以下步骤:
- 数据清洗:处理缺失值、异常值和重复数据。
- 特征选择:通过相关性分析或模型重要性评分(如随机森林的featureimportances)筛选关键特征。
- 数据增强:在图像任务中,通过旋转、裁剪等操作扩充数据集,提升模型泛化能力。
3. 主流工具链与框架
- 深度学习框架:TensorFlow(支持静态图与动态图)、PyTorch(动态计算图,易调试)和飞桨(PaddlePaddle,国内自主研发)。
- 机器学习库:Scikit-learn(传统算法)、XGBoost(梯度提升树)和LightGBM(高效树模型)。
- 数据处理工具:Pandas(结构化数据处理)、NumPy(数值计算)和OpenCV(计算机视觉)。
最佳实践:初学者建议从PyTorch或飞桨入门,因其API设计更贴近Python生态,调试效率更高。
三、AI行业应用场景与案例解析
1. 计算机视觉:从识别到理解
- 应用场景:人脸识别(安防)、医学影像分析(辅助诊断)和工业质检(缺陷检测)。
- 案例:某制造企业通过部署基于YOLOv5的目标检测模型,将产品缺陷检出率提升至99%,同时减少人工巡检成本60%。
2. 自然语言处理:从理解到生成
- 应用场景:智能客服(问答系统)、机器翻译(跨语言沟通)和内容生成(新闻摘要、代码辅助)。
- 案例:某金融平台利用BERT模型构建智能投顾系统,通过分析用户咨询文本自动推荐理财产品,响应时间缩短至2秒内。
3. 语音技术:从识别到合成
- 应用场景:语音助手(智能家居)、语音转写(会议记录)和有声读物生成。
- 技术挑战:方言识别、噪声环境下的准确率优化需结合声学模型与语言模型联合训练。
四、开发者入门指南:从学习到实践
1. 学习路径建议
- 基础阶段:掌握Python编程、线性代数与概率论基础,通过Kaggle竞赛熟悉数据科学流程。
- 进阶阶段:深入学习至少一个深度学习框架,复现经典论文(如ResNet、Transformer)。
- 实战阶段:参与开源项目或企业级AI平台(如飞桨AI Studio)的模型开发,积累工程化经验。
2. 企业应用架构设计
- 云端部署方案:利用容器化技术(如Docker+Kubernetes)实现模型服务化,结合某云厂商的弹性计算资源动态扩展。
- 边缘计算优化:在资源受限设备(如摄像头、机器人)上部署轻量化模型(如MobileNet、TinyML),通过模型压缩技术(量化、剪枝)降低计算开销。
3. 性能优化思路
- 训练加速:使用混合精度训练(FP16+FP32)和分布式数据并行(DDP)缩短训练时间。
- 推理优化:采用ONNX格式统一模型表示,通过TensorRT等工具生成优化后的推理引擎,提升GPU利用率。
五、未来趋势与挑战
- 多模态融合:结合文本、图像、语音等多模态数据,构建更接近人类认知的AI系统(如CLIP模型)。
- 可解释性AI:通过SHAP、LIME等工具解释模型决策过程,满足金融、医疗等高风险领域的合规需求。
- 伦理与安全:需关注数据隐私(如差分隐私技术)、算法偏见(如公平性约束)和模型安全性(如对抗样本防御)。
结语:人工智能已从实验室走向产业界,成为数字化转型的核心驱动力。对于开发者而言,掌握算法原理与工程实践同等重要;对于企业用户,需结合业务场景选择合适的技术方案,并关注长期可维护性。未来,随着大模型与通用人工智能(AGI)的演进,AI将进一步重塑人类社会的工作与生活模式。